摘要
通过形态学和分子生物学相结合的方法 ,将内生真菌B3初步定为半知菌中的拟茎点霉属 (Phomopsissp .) .通过盆栽试验和扫描电镜观察表明 ,内生真菌B3有很好的降解秸秆的能力 ,尤其是对木质素的降解 ,而且对后季作物生长没有危害 .进一步研究木质素酶的性质表明 ,菌株B3分泌的漆酶有很好的耐热性 ,粗酶液在pH为 6 0— 8 0时 ,酶活较为稳定 .
According to morphologic and molecular biological characterization,strain B3 was identified as Phomopsis sp.The effect of the strain B3 on wheat straw degradation was studied by pot experiments and scanning electron microscope.The results showed that the strain could decompose the wheat straw efficiently especially the lignin.Moreover,it did no pese harm to the next crops.Further results on its ligninase characteristics indicated that the crude Laccase was thermostable and its activity was stable at pH 6.0—8.0.
